lmao this makes me laugh. not at your skill level just the picture itself. I see that you did try and shade yourself appropriately for the pic, which is good. a lot of people forget simple shading, which can make tremendous difference. BUT, your face in the end result is too blurred, it is not as crisp as the surroundings, so it doesnt look natural. touch up on that maybe tweak the saturation down a little bit and i think it will be good!
 
You caught the bug alright Belial.

I'll have to agree, tho. your remodelled face is a tad blurred and over saturated. I must add that tho your eyes are in the correct position, everything below is off. Copy your nose, mouth and goatee to a new layer and with your nose bridge as the central axis, rotate Counter clockwise about a couple of degrees to line them up to the chin area.
